Overview

Set on over forty acres of fertile red soil and ancient old-growth forest, this owner-built estate represents a unique blend of exquisite craftsmanship and untouched natural beauty. The residence is thoughtfully designed to harmonize with its surroundings, utilizing Tasmania's finest timbers including Myrtle, King Billy Pine, and Fiddleback Oak, creating a home that feels like a natural extension of the landscape.

The Land & Infrastructure
This property offers more than just a home; it embodies a complete rural lifestyle. The expansive 42-acre holding includes:

  • Water & Power Security: Equipped with a 50-panel solar array, modern solar hot water system, two large underground water tanks, and an environmental wastewater system, ensuring true self-sufficiency.
  • Productive Earth: The rich red soil supports a year-round hothouse and established fruit trees including apple, pear, citrus, cherry, olive, and kiwi. The property also features chicken coops and stockyards.
  • Extensive Shedding: Five substantial sheds are present, including a dam-side workshop with 3-phase power and high-clearance storage suitable for a caravan, boat, or tractor.

The Private Ecosystem
At the heart of the property lies a flow-through dam, a private sanctuary with unlimited water access under your own water licence. The dam includes a pontoon, a "teenage shack," and a stone-fireplace BBQ area, serving as a habitat for platypus, trout, and ducks. Nearby, a secret native bee garden and a children's treehouse provide a magical connection to the Tasmanian bush.

The Residence
The home features a distinctive turret-style entry and cathedral ceilings crafted from Macrocarpa and Tas Oak, creating a spacious and warm atmosphere.

  • The Master Retreat: A soundproof upper-level sanctuary offering panoramic sea and mountain views, complete with a private balcony.
  • The Heart of the Home: A chef's kitchen and open-plan living area with Myrtle floorboards and a feature wood fire with an external-loading woodbox.
  • Wellness & Work: A 10-metre indoor heated pool and spa beneath soaring timber ceilings, alongside a dedicated home office with bespoke Myrtle cabinetry.

Lovingly enhanced over two decades, this property nurtures the soul. Whether farming the soil, exploring the old-growth forest, or enjoying sunsets over Bass Strait from the balcony, this estate offers the ultimate Tasmanian retreat.

Conveniently located just 5 minutes from Penguin, 10 minutes from Burnie with schools and hospital access, 15 minutes from Ulverstone, and 30 minutes from Burnie and Devonport airports, the property balances seclusion with accessibility. It is ideal for those seeking a private family estate, lifestyle retreat, or unique sanctuary in Tasmania.
